1-1 of 1
Authors: Hongyu Zhao
Sort by
Journal Article
ACCEPTED MANUSCRIPT
Zibaguli Wubulikasimu and others
Protein & Cell, pwaf013, https://doi.org/10.1093/procel/pwaf013
Published: 19 February 2025